ZywOo — Mathieu Herbaut
Quick Facts
Introduction: Who Is ZywOo?
If you follow Counter-Strike at any level, you have almost certainly encountered the name ZywOo. Mathieu Herbaut, known to the competitive community as ZywOo, is a French professional Counter-Strike 2 player who competes for Team Vitality. He is widely considered one of the greatest players in the history of the franchise, and a legitimate contender for the title of the best to ever touch the game.
ZywOo earned his first HLTV Player of the Year award in 2019, becoming both the youngest recipient and the first French player to claim the honor. Since then, he has won the award four times total, surpassing the record previously shared with Oleksandr “s1mple” Kostyliev. He has won three Major championships, earned over thirty MVP medals, and maintained a world-class rating across thousands of professional maps.
What makes ZywOo remarkable is not just his mechanical skill, though that alone would place him among the elite. It is the consistency, adaptability, and quiet composure he brings to every match. He transitioned seamlessly from CS:GO to CS2, continued to dominate the scene, and has built a legacy that only a handful of esports players in any discipline can match.
Professional Career Timeline
Early Teams and the Path to Vitality (2016–2018)
ZywOo’s competitive career began around 2016, when he started appearing on small French rosters including aAa and other lower-tier squads. During this period he was still developing as a player, but even at this stage, the numbers he was putting up against regional competition were remarkable. He was playing well above his peers, and scouts across Europe took notice.
In late 2018, Team Vitality signed ZywOo, bringing him into a tier-one environment for the first time. The move was a turning point, both for ZywOo personally and for Vitality as an organization. From the moment he joined the main roster, it became clear that Vitality had acquired something special.
The Breakout Year: 2019
ZywOo’s first full year on Vitality was nothing short of extraordinary. The team won ECS Season 7 Finals and EPICENTER 2019, finished as runners-up at ESL One Cologne and DreamHack Masters Malmö, and consistently competed at the highest level. ZywOo individually earned five MVP awards and posted a 1.30 overall LAN rating for the year. In January 2020, HLTV named him the best player of 2019, making him the youngest recipient of the award in its history at just 19 years old.
Sustained Excellence: 2020–2022
The 2020 season was disrupted by the global pandemic, with most events moving online. Despite the changed landscape, ZywOo earned a second consecutive Player of the Year award, joining an exclusive club. Over the next two years, Vitality went through roster changes and structural adjustments, and while ZywOo continued to perform at an elite individual level, the team’s results at Majors were not yet matching expectations. He finished second in the HLTV rankings in both 2021 and 2022, behind s1mple and then NiKo, respectively.
The Major Breakthrough: Paris 2023
The BLAST.tv Paris Major 2023 was a defining moment. Vitality, playing on home soil in France, won the Major title with ZywOo delivering a masterful performance throughout the tournament. He was named Major MVP, and the victory cemented his legacy as a complete player who could perform on the biggest stage. He went on to win a third HLTV Player of the Year award for 2023.
2024: A Rare Dip
By ZywOo’s impossibly high standards, 2024 was a step back. Vitality fell in the semi-finals of PGL Major Copenhagen and the quarterfinals of the Perfect World Shanghai Major. ZywOo finished the year ranked third by HLTV, behind donk and m0NESY. For anyone else, a top-three global ranking would be a career highlight, but for ZywOo, it served as motivation.
2025: Historic Domination
ZywOo responded with arguably the greatest individual season in Counter-Strike history. Vitality won nine tournaments, including both Majors of the year: the BLAST Austin Major and the StarLadder Budapest Major. ZywOo collected eight MVP awards in a single calendar year, broke the all-time record for total HLTV MVPs previously held by s1mple, and was named HLTV Player of the Year for a record fourth time. He also won AWPer of the Year and was recognized as the Esports Breakthrough Player of the Decade at the 2025 Esports Decade Awards.
His run of seven consecutive tournament victories with Vitality in the first half of the year, accompanied by six straight MVP awards, was a stretch of dominance rarely seen in any competitive game.
Playing Style and Role
ZywOo is classified as an AWPer, but that label significantly undersells what he brings to a team. He is a true hybrid star, equally dangerous with the AWP, AK-47, or M4A1-S. His ability to shift between the primary AWP role and a secondary rifling role depending on the economy and tactical situation makes him one of the most versatile players in the game’s history.
His AWP play is characterized by aggressive peeks, fast reaction times, and an uncanny sense of timing that often catches opponents off-guard. Unlike some AWPers who rely on passive angles, ZywOo frequently takes initiative, creating openings for his team through individual plays. When he does hold a position, his shot accuracy is among the highest ever recorded at the professional level.
On the rifle, ZywOo demonstrates spray control and crosshair placement that rival dedicated entry fraggers. His ability to clutch rounds in high-pressure situations has become legendary, and his composure in elimination matches is a significant reason Vitality have been so dominant in playoff brackets.

Interesting Facts and Highlights
1. ZywOo shares his birthday, November 9, with the original release date of Counter-Strike (November 9, 2000). He was quite literally born alongside the game he would go on to dominate.
2. Despite his status as one of the most successful esports athletes in the world, ZywOo is known for being reserved and soft-spoken. He lets his in-game performances speak for him, rarely engaging in public trash talk or social media controversies.
3. ZywOo’s approach to practice is notably disciplined. He has stated that he never pulled all-night gaming sessions growing up and that his family always maintained boundaries around his screen time. This stands in contrast to many professional gamers who describe spending entire days grinding from a young age.
4. He has his own signature mouse, the Pulsar ZywOo The Chosen, designed to match his claw-fingertip hybrid grip. The mouse reflects his preference for lightweight, precise peripherals.
5. ZywOo was awarded the Esports Breakthrough Player of the Decade at the 2025 Esports Decade Awards and was nominated for Best Esports Athlete at The Game Awards 2025.
6. Vitality completed the ESL Grand Slam Season 5 with ZywOo on the roster, a feat that requires winning four different ESL premier events within a set timeframe.
Why ZywOo Matters in Esports
ZywOo’s significance extends well beyond his personal accolades. He represents what sustained, quiet excellence looks like in an industry that often rewards loud personalities and viral moments. In a scene where narratives around players can shift dramatically from year to year, ZywOo has remained at the pinnacle for the better part of a decade.
His career arc also illustrates the global reach of competitive Counter-Strike. As a French player, ZywOo brought new attention to the Western European scene and proved that the region could produce generational talent on par with anything from Eastern Europe, Scandinavia, or Brazil. Team Vitality’s dominance with ZywOo as their centerpiece has elevated the organization into one of the most prestigious brands in all of esports.
For aspiring players, ZywOo provides a model of how to build a career. His emphasis on consistency over flashiness, his willingness to adapt his role to serve the team, and his approach to practice all offer lessons that extend far beyond Counter-Strike. He is proof that you do not need to burn yourself out to reach the top — you need to be deliberate, focused, and patient.
Outlook: What’s Next for ZywOo
As of early 2026, ZywOo and Team Vitality remain the team to beat in Counter-Strike 2. Vitality have continued their strong form, winning BLAST Open Rotterdam 2026, and ZywOo shows no signs of slowing down. He is 25 years old, which places him in what is traditionally considered the prime window for professional Counter-Strike players.
The question is no longer whether ZywOo can win another Major or claim another Player of the Year award. The question is how many more he will collect before his career is over. With the CS2 competitive ecosystem continuing to grow and prize pools expanding, ZywOo has every opportunity to further extend the records he has already set. Barring injuries or unexpected roster changes, expect to see him competing at the highest level for several more years.

ZYWOO CS2 SETTINGS — COMPLETE CONFIGURATION GUIDE
The following sections detail ZywOo’s current CS2 configuration as of April 2026. These settings are sourced from verified professional settings databases and reflect his active tournament setup. Settings can change over time, so always cross-reference with sources like prosettings.net or specs.gg for the latest values.
ZywOo Mouse and Sensitivity Settings
ZywOo’s eDPI of 800 sits squarely in the middle range for professional CS2 players. This balance allows him to execute precise rifle sprays while retaining enough speed for AWP flick shots. His philosophy is to find a sensitivity and commit to it permanently, letting muscle memory develop over months and years rather than constantly adjusting.
ZywOo Video Settings
ZywOo plays on a stretched 4:3 aspect ratio, which is common among professional AWPers because it makes enemy character models appear wider on screen. He keeps shadow quality high because player shadows provide critical tactical information about enemy positions around corners. Particle detail is set to low to reduce visual clutter during firefights.
ZywOo Crosshair Settings
ZywOo uses a small, clean crosshair with no center dot. The tight gap creates a compact aiming point that allows for precise headshot placement at long range without obscuring the target. The static style ensures the crosshair remains stable during movement and firing, which helps with consistent aim under pressure.
ZywOo Viewmodel Settings
The viewmodel is positioned to the far right and slightly lowered, which keeps the weapon model out of the center of the screen and maximizes visibility. This is a common choice among professionals because it provides a cleaner field of view for spotting enemy movement while still keeping the weapon model visible enough for recoil reference.
ZywOo Config Snippet
Below is a consolidated console command snippet that replicates ZywOo’s core settings. Paste these into your CS2 autoexec.cfg or developer console to apply them instantly.
// ZywOo CS2 Config Snippet — April 2026
// Mouse & Sensitivity
sensitivity "2"
zoom_sensitivity_ratio "1"
// Crosshair
cl_crosshairstyle 4
cl_crosshairsize 1.5
cl_crosshairthickness 0.1
cl_crosshairgap -2.6
cl_crosshaircolor 4
cl_crosshaircolor_r 255
cl_crosshaircolor_g 255
cl_crosshaircolor_b 255
cl_crosshairalpha 255
cl_crosshairdot 0
cl_crosshair_drawoutline 1
cl_crosshair_t 0
// Viewmodel
viewmodel_fov 68
viewmodel_offset_x 2.5
viewmodel_offset_y 0
viewmodel_offset_z -1.5
viewmodel_presetpos 2
// Launch Options
-novid -tickrate 128 -allow_third_party_software
